    Conditional Use Permit

    Dear Ephraim City Property Owner, Janika Soernson has requested a conditional use permit from Ephraim City to open a dog boarding and grooming business on the property at approximately 716 N 80 E (in the C2 zone). Read on...
  2. Zoning icon

    Lot Split

    Dear Ephraim City property owner, Whitney Wilkinson is requesting approval for a two-lot subdivision from Ephraim City on his property located at approximately 541 S 400 E. Read on...
